Car Care Clinic
maintenance · Oil change · Tire Dealer · Tire service
0.0(0 Reviews)
4050 Pemberton Square Blvd, 39180 Vicksburg
Info
Car Care Clinic offers a full range of automotive services and is all about customer relations, friendliness, and top quality professional service.
Map
4050 Pemberton Square Blvd, 39180 Vicksburg
Reviews
Unverified Reviews0.0
(0 Reviews)